Output 94caaaf23add7a58b2f8c5b3b60d61b07d0c0f846c78d0bac1d8b53f568dab8c:76

value
1670572
script pubkey
OP_0 OP_PUSHBYTES_20 f6588aa64897ed94ffbda5754d0a01e3d554b274
address
bc1q7evg4fjgjlkeflaa54656zspu024fvn5x0qhkd
transaction
94caaaf23add7a58b2f8c5b3b60d61b07d0c0f846c78d0bac1d8b53f568dab8c
spent
true